What it is
The product is a lightweight formulation designed to provide hydration to the skin. It contains a combination of plant proteins, vitamins, peptides, and a stem cell extract from alpine roses, which aim to facilitate hydration at multiple levels. The product includes a complex of natural bio-ferments intended to enhance nutrient density and absorption efficiency, along with caffeine for potential skin revitalization and various coconut elements for conditioning.
Key ingredients and their functions
- Rhododendron Ferrugineum Leaf Cell Culture Extract - conditioning agent
- Pseudoalteromonas Ferment Extract - conditioning agent
- Caffeine - stimulant
- Coconut Alkanes - emollient
- Squalane - moisturizer
- Sodium Hyaluronate - humectant
- Hydrolyzed Corn Starch - skin conditioning
- Jojoba Seed Oil - moisturizer
How it works
The formulation is designed to improve skin appearance by delivering hydration and conditioning. Rhododendron Ferrugineum Leaf Cell Culture Extract potentially conditions the skin, while Pseudoalteromonas Ferment Extract may offer similar benefits. Caffeine is included to provide an energizing effect, potentially making the skin feel revitalized. Coconut Alkanes and Squalane serve as emollients and moisturizers to support a smooth skin texture. Sodium Hyaluronate is used as a humectant, which can aid in moisture retention. Hydrolyzed Corn Starch offers skin conditioning properties, and Jojoba Seed Oil functions as a moisturizer, all working together to support hydrated and conditioned skin.
